Gtk opengl mac download

Source downloads for unixbsdlinux, windows binaries. Older dlls compiled with mingw are available from download page version 2. Source code, rpms, fedora, flatpak, suse, gentoo, ubuntu, linux mint, arch linux, solus, slackware, freebsd, mac os x, ms windows, msvc development package. These data types ensure that the code can be recompiled on any platform without making any changes. This edition is supported by the manjaro arm team and comes with the i3 tiling window manager. The visual studio for mac debugger lets you step inside your code by setting breakpoints, step over statements, step into and out of functions, and inspect the current state of the code stack through powerful visualizations. It is licensed under the terms of the gnu lesser general public license, allowing both free and proprietary software to use it.

Otherwise, feel free to look at the changelog you may also want to look at some games. Have a look at our getting started, faq, and tutorials pages on our wiki. Net for building websites, services, and console apps. What i have so far is one gtk window that contains all of the gtk widgets, and a glutfreeglut window that houses the opengl image. Boldface denotes packages built by the main developers. A dialog will confirm that opengl acceleration is enabled for remote desktop and if a reboot is required. Extract the patch tarball over your extracted copy of the snes9x source. Download and update opengl drivers for windows 10, 8, 7. Mac pro introduced in early 2008 or later xserve models introduced in early 2009. The xquartz project is an opensource effort to develop a version of the x. When writing code with gtk, we often find that many of the primitive data types are prefixed with g, as in gint, gchar, gshort, gpointer, and so forth. Development tools downloads nvidia opengl sdk by nvidia corporation and many more programs are available for instant and free download.

Opengl greatly eases the task of writing realtime 2d or 3d graphics applications by providing a mature, welldocumented graphics processing pipeline that supports the abstraction of current and future hardware accelerators. Opengl extension to gtk general information gtkglext is an opengl extension to gtk. If you are interested in developing an app, get started now by developing this example application. By taking advantage of gtk being a crossplatform development tool and its easy to use api, you can develop amazing apps using the gtk. Games provide basic game play for the engine to run using lua scripts. Our antivirus scan shows that this mac download is safe. This package is composed of gdkglext library and gtkglext library. Clutter is a gobjectbased graphics library for creating hardwareaccelerated user interfaces. How to install mac os mojave theme mcmojave in ubuntu 18.

Gtkglext is an extension to gtk which adds opengl capabilities to gtkwidget. Install opengl opengl software runtime is included as part of operating system. I think that gdkglext is more important than gtkglext. Alternatively you could try to update python to v2. How to install opengl windows install your favorite integrated development environment ide. Opengl the industry standard for high performance graphics.

Gtk gui software free download gtk gui top 4 download. On some platforms, we have provided a few prebuilt binaries for convenience, but wxwidgets supports so many. This simple tutorial shows how to install mcmojave, a mac os mojave like theme, in ubuntu 18. Gvr gtk this is the new design based on gtk glade and is meant for gnulinux systems and windows xp systems. If you wish to update intel, amd, or nvidia opengl drivers for windows 10, 8, 7 or mac, this post will show you the most effective methods.

If you havent yet experimented with gtk s new opengl support, emmanuele bassi has written a lengthy and very informative blog post about all of the essential facts for this new feature and how to get started. It also ensures that this framebuffer is the default gl rendering target when rendering. How it works is that when the button on the ui is clicked, a new gtk thread is created to display the glutfreeglut window that contains the opengl rendered image. It has a full featured gui, working netplay, controller support, opengl or xvideo rendering plus much more.

Gtkglarea is a widget that allows drawing with opengl. Mac games are more real, more powerful, and more fun. Gdk supports rendering windows using opengl for x11 and wayland using. In particular, it means you cannot alterreplace the installer to bundle avidemux with other programs for example. Gvr xo is the gtk version meant to be used on a olpc xolaptop.

The source code to this release has been signed by sam lantinga. Dec 19, 2016 install opencv 3 on macos with homebrew the easy way the remainder of this blog post demonstrates how to install opencv 3 with both python 2. Along with qt, it is one of the most popular toolkits for the wayland and x11 windowing systems. Clutter is an openglbased interactive canvas library and does not contain. I3 is an extremely lightweight tiling window manager, famous for its efficiency with screen space and keyboard controlled workflow.

Pygtk for mac lies within developer tools, more precisely ide. Opentk provides several utility libraries, including a mathlinear algebra package, a windowing system, and input handling. This page provides links to both general release drivers that support opengl 4. Oct 28, 2019 get wxwidgets from the wxpython, wxperl, or wxhaskell download sites. Gtkglext is just a simple support library which enables developers to use opengl with gtkdrawingarea. But you can install bluestacks from here and enjoy all your android features using this software on your mac. The opengl extensions viewer is a free application designed by realtech vr. Manjaro arm with the lightweight tiling window manager i3. Nvidia continues to support opengl as well through technical papers and our large set of examples on our nvidia graphics sdk.

Jun 04, 2016 java project tutorial make login and register form step by step using netbeans and mysql database duration. Windows dlls of freetype can also be downloaded directly from a github repository version 2. Nowadays we have a very powerful app player named bluestacks. When installing wxwidgets on windows or os x, we always recommend building the library from source yourself, and only provide the source package for most platforms.

If gdkglext library is integrated into gdk, gtkdrawingarea will be able to support opengl, and gtkglext library will go away. Gtkglextmm opengl rendering for gtkmm gtkmozembedmm mozillabased web browser widget. Configure wx to use opengl and unicodeconfigure with gtk with opengl enableunicode make make install. And then apply new themes and tweak the left dock to make your ubuntu desktop look like mac. Deluge is a lightweight, free software, crossplatform bittorrent client.

Please report back, if one of the above suggestions fixes the problem for you thanks. Feel free to download bluestacks for your mac computer imac, mac pro, macbook airpro 201718 year. This tutorial assumes that you have microsoft visual studio installed on your machine. Get wxwidgets from the wxpython, wxperl, or wxhaskell download sites. Some of the projects which have used gtk on mac os x have shared their. Download for windows 8 and 7 64bit download for windows 10. They are generally available when a new release is announced. Go to opengl extensions viewer windows, and click the appropriate link to download the opengl extensions viewer from the mac app store, itunes store, or the android market, depending on the device and operating system. Gtkglarea sets up its own gdkglcontext for the window it creates, and creates a custom gl framebuffer that the widget will do gl rendering onto. It runs on all major platforms and powers hundreds of apps, games and scientific research. In addition to the wrappers distributed with gtkmm and gnomemm, additional widgets and libraries are available from other sources. Unpack the archive and cd into the top level directory.

Why macos mojave requires metal and deprecates opengl. Find downloads for packages, developer builds, and projects. Together with supporting libraries and applications, it forms the x11. After missing their original target of transitioning to intel gallium3d by default for mesa 19. Gtk gui software free download gtk gui top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. You can get the public key from any keyserver with the key id 0xa7763be6, or directly from sams home page. Contribute to gtkd developersgtkd development by creating an account on github. Install opencv 3 on macos with homebrew the easy way. Sep 19, 2003 i think that gdkglext is more important than gtkglext. Coreaudio and opengl for in and output, saving the overhead of crossplattform apis like sdl, fmod or gtk. Opengl rendering context gdkglcontext can also be obtained via gtk.

Pyopengl is the most common cross platform python binding to opengl and related apis. Mac games are more real, more powerful and more fun. Originally developed by silicon graphics in the early 90s, opengl has become the most widelyused open graphics standard in the world. Use the visual studio debugger to quickly find and fix bugs across languages. Availability of binary packages might take a short while. Opengl is an open, crossplatform graphics standard with broad industry support. Will open a small window with a rotating, shaded cube that you can interact with with the mouse.

Opengl for macintosh enables your computer to display threedimensional graphics using applications designed to take advantage of opengl. Do you have a favorite gtk application that youd like to run on your mac with a. Following steps will first download and install the gtk theme, icons theme, and a set of wallpapers. Since none of the pycam developers is a mac os user, it is not easy for us to track down this issue. To install opengl, doubleclick the installer icon in the opengl.

26 773 341 185 783 1244 54 975 458 1059 1359 1564 270 767 1408 566 1396 1302 722 1339 407 1462 684 541 733 323 416 451 1252 1122 557 768